The Zohar does speak of the fact that in order to release an arrow, an archer must first pull the string back toward his own heart. Before we can confront the negativity in the outer world we have to confront and defeat it in ourselves. And we must do this, because we have an obligation to take action against the negative side. It’s not about killing anything. It’s about tikkun olam, healing the world. As soon that’s accomplished we’ll be back in the Garden, where everything is on the house!
